### Properties of PVDF Sheet & Rods PVDF sheets and rods exhibit several key properties: 1. **Chemical Resistance:** Exceptional resistance to a wide range of chemicals, making it ideal for harsh chemical environments. 2. **Mechanical Strength:** High tensile strength, suitable for applications requiring durability and resistance to wear and tear. 3. **Thermal Stability:** Withstands high temperatures, suitable for use in high-temperature environments. 4. **Purity:** High purity, essential for applications where contamination must be minimized. 5. **Electrical Properties:** Excellent dielectric properties, suitable for electrical applications. 6. **Radiation Resistance:** Excellent resistance to radiation, suitable for environments where exposure to radiation is a concern. ### Applications of PVDF Sheet & Rods PVDF sheets and rods find use in various industries and applications, including: 1. **Chemical Processing:** Equipment such as pumps, valves, and piping systems. 2. **Semiconductor Manufacturing:** Equipment like wafer carriers and chemical delivery systems. 3. **Pharmaceutical Manufacturing:** Equipment including mixing tanks and filtration systems. 4. **Aerospace and Defense:** Applications like radar domes and missile components. 5. **Electrical and Electronics:** Insulators, capacitors, and other electronic components. ### Advantages of PVDF Sheet & Rods PVDF sheets and rods offer several advantages: 1. **Versatility:** Suitable for a wide range of applications across various industries. 2. **Durability:** High mechanical strength and resistance to wear and tear ensure long service life. 3. **Cost-Effectiveness:** Comparatively cost-effective compared to other high-performance thermoplastics. 4. **Ease of Fabrication:** Can be easily fabricated into various shapes and sizes, including sheets and rods. ### Conclusion PVDF sheets and rods offer a unique combination of properties suitable for a wide range of applications across various industries. Their chemical resistance, mechanical strength, thermal stability, purity, electrical properties, and radiation resistance make them ideal for use in chemical processing, semiconductor manufacturing, pharmaceutical manufacturing, aerospace and defense, and electrical and electronic applications. The versatility, durability, cost-effectiveness, and ease of fabrication of PVDF make it a highly attractive material for many applications.
